CFHLA 2007 Hotelier of the Year Award Presented
Peter Kacheris of the Walt Disney World Swan & Dolphin Resorts
ORLANDO, FL. December 17, 2007. On Saturday, December 15th, the Central Florida Hotel & Lodging Association hosted the 2007 Hospitality Gala at the JW Marriott Orlando, Grande Lakes. Over 1,100 hospitality executives and local elected officials attended this event. Ten thousand dollars ($10,000) from the evening's silent auction proceeds were distributed to the "Central Florida YMCA After School Middle School Programs."
Following the evening's charity check presentation, CFHLA presented its annual awards; the CFHLA Hotelier of the Year, the CFHLA Allied Member of the Year, the CFHLA Engineer of the Year, and the prestigious Charles Andrews Memorial Hospitality Award for Community Leadership. The CFHLA 2007 Hotelier of the Year award was presented to Peter Kacheris, of the Walt Disney World Swan & Dolphin Resorts, for his dedication and devotion to CFHLA programs and events over the last 6 years he's been a member of the association.
Mr. Mark McHugh, CEO of Gatorland, was the 2007 CFHLA "Charles Andrews Memorial Hospitality Award for Community Leadership" recipient. Each year, the award honors one local leader for their contribution to the area's tourism industry through community service. This award is the "highest honor" bestowed upon an individual by CFHLA, in recognition of their achievements and contributions to the Central Florida hospitality industry and the community at large. The award is named after the founding father of CFHLA, Charles Andrews, and exemplifies perseverance and dedication to a cause.
"Mark McHugh's dedication to the Orlando area embodies the spirit and intent of this award," stated CFHLA President Rich Maladecki. "Specifically, CFHLA leadership is proud to recognize Mark for his accomplishments relating to leading and managing the Orlando/Orange County Convention & Visitors Bureau's transitions of the last 24 months. They included the introduction of the enhanced marketing campaign, as well as the hiring of a new CVB President. The CFHLA Board felt Mark was a natural recipient for this year's award."
The 2007 Allied Member of the Year award went to George Fakhoury, North Florida Area Manager of Sales and Marketing of Dollar Thrifty Automotive Group, for his dedication and support of CFHLA programs and committees over the last 10 years of his CFHLA membership.
The 2007 Engineer of the Year award was presented to Michael Smukall, of the Holiday Inn SunSpree Resort, for his commitment and support of the CFHLA Engineers Council programs and for his engineering expertise.
